Soji’s forward tilt only lifts the back of the seat pan. It doesn’t bring the back forward to provide support. I’ve sat in other chairs like that and hated them for it. It feels like they’re trying to dump you off the seat. I’d go with the Leap every time. But don’t get one without a return option. BTOD and Crandall are both running great coupons right now.
